Last time I played, I've seen pure nodes get corrupted a minute after I find them, and the silverwood grove is no exception. I would probably go on to say that the silverwood grove is a risky place to go because you are in a forest, and you have to clear out all the trees because the taint turns alot of it into swarm spawners, and those keep coming back until you can clear out all the tainted wood they're spawning from. Everywhere starts off as tainted, and in some cases including inside the biodomes. I've died from going afk, and taint spreading into the biodome, then getting killed by a tainted chicken or something.

I never had issues growing oak trees inside the biodomes. Also I thought there were a few dirt blocks in Omega? If there aren't any then yeah it's probably the most difficult dome to get started in, as it should be. You'll also have trouble getting animals to spawn there since they don't spawn on grass in ocean biomes. Also if taint grows into your biodome you hosed it up somehow, probably by destroying your silverwood tree.
